IMO, it is not really about who rules this country especially when it comes to the issue of tackling corruption.
The biggest problem the polity has now is the national assembly and the governors forum.
It wont be easy for anybody to fight corruption with those gluttons called honorables still sitting in that house.
The house of assembly that is supposed to check the executive is way too corrupt and lacks the moral standing to question mr president, all they wait for is a share of the pie.
The governors forum is the single most unified and powerful force in this country.
They decide who becomes councilor, LG chairman, commissioner, they appoint people that will become ministers at the federal level, they decide who becomes house of assembly memebers.
These governors are way powerful and sadly they are mostly rogues and too bad they decide who becomes president since they each have to deliver their states.
This is how nigerian politics work and it looks like there are no options in the mean time.
If jonathan pumps money to these governors like he did during the previous elections, be sure he's gonna win.
